Design Tailored for How People in India Use Their Phones
We design for how Indian users actually interact with their devices. That means accounting for varying internet speeds, different screen sizes, and multiple languages. Your grandmother should be able to navigate your app without needing help.
Developing and Testing in Real-World Conditions
We test apps on older Android phones with spotty 3G connections, not just the latest iPhones with perfect WiFi. Your app should work in Tier 2 cities during rush hour, not only in a developer's office.

Designed for the Realities of the Indian Market
Building apps for India involves tackling challenges that aren't present in Silicon Valley. Uneven network access, users speaking many languages, a wide range of devices, and a variety of payment methods.
We've partnered with companies across twelve states. A delivery app that runs smoothly in Bangalore could stumble in Patna if local realities aren't considered.
- Offline operation when connectivity drops
- Support for local languages and scripts
- Various payment methods, including cash on delivery integration
- Optimized for budget Android devices
- Data-conscious design for limited data plans
